The Pirates take on the Yankees at Himself Field at 1:05 PM, with Jameson Taillon on the mound. Tom Prince will manage the next two games, as Clint Hurdle is attending a funeral. Francisco Cervelli will be playing his last game for the Pirates before joining Team Italy in the WBC, which makes me pretty nervous. Today’s lineup is a Sunday special, but it’s still a lot more interesting than the broken down veterans we saw so much in the past:
- Max Moroff, SS
- Alen Hanson, 2B
- Francisco Cervelli, DH
- John Jaso, 1B
- Eric Wood, 3B
- Jose Osuna, RF
- Barrett Barnes, LF
- Jacob Stallings, C
- Danny Ortiz, CF
Following Taillon will be Nick Kingham, Clay Holmes, Antonio Bastardo, A.J. Schugel and Dan Runzler.
